First, understand that “Gradual Buildup” is essentially a clue type, not a specific definition. This means the answer can be a noun, verb, adjective, or even a phrase. The key is that the answer relates to a process of gradual increase or accumulation.

Here’s what you need to consider when tackling a “Gradual Buildup” clue:

Think about the context:

What’s the surrounding theme of the crossword? Is it a word puzzle, a cryptic, or a themed puzzle? This can give you hints about the answer’s nature.

Look for synonyms:

Consider words like “accumulation,” “escalation,” “progression,” or “growth.” Do any of these fit the context of the clue?

Think outside the box:

“Gradual Buildup” might not be a direct synonym for the answer. It could be a metaphorical way of describing the answer’s meaning or function.
